The purpose of this position is to further the goals of the Bureau of Forestry’s Urban & Community Forestry Program, specifically in the northern region of the Chesapeake Bay Watershed. This program seeks to educate citizens and increase quality of life for Pennsylvanians in urban/suburban settings through tree planting and tree care work. The urban and community forestry program helps citizens understand the myriad benefits of planting trees, the importance of keeping existing trees in the community healthy, and the value of sufficient tree canopy. The program also encourages and provides outlets for citizens and municipalities to take action to improve their urban and community forest and increase local capacity and trust-building within communities. Specifically, the Chesapeake Bay Community Tree Specialist will: Guide and manage the TreeVitalize program in the Chesapeake Bay region, building partnerships and providing leadership and coordination among the TreeVitalize partners in the bay watershed.Creatively and equitably engage the public and new partners in the Bay.Build capacity for a minimum of 5 cities/towns at the local tree level to provide staffing assistance, ordinance advising, creation of advocacy groups, and creation or updates of canopy plans.Provide strategic input and direction, assistance, and information to the State TreeVitalize staff about work in the Chesapeake Bay region.Planting and survival verification work.Interested in learning more?
